Among the sixteen sides there are nine Bundesliga clubs, four 2. Bundesliga sides , two 3. Bundesliga outfits and amazingly one Regionalliga side.
Half of the teams that were in the draw are previous winners of the Germany's second biggest prize on offer. Record Champions, Bayern Munich, Borussia Mönchengladbach, Werder Bremen, Borussia Dortmund, Kickers Offenbach, 1. FC Köln, 1. FC Kaiserslautern and last but not least Bayer Leverkusen. The most recent winners of the competition are Bayern Munich who are then followed by Borussia Dortmund and then Werder Bremen.
Tournament top scorer Sven Schipplock will have the opportunity to add to his already six strong tally after his side, Hoffenheim very convincingly progressed into the third round .
Fixtures:
Bayer Leverkusen-1. FC Kaiserslautern
Kickers Offenbach- Borussia Mönchengladbach
Bayern Munich-Eintracht Braunschweig
VFR Aalen-Hoffenheim
RB Leipzig-Vfl Wolfsburg
Arminia Bielefeld-Werder Bremen
SC Freiburg-1. FC Köln
Dynamo Dresden-Borussia Dortmund
Ties will be played over the third and fourth of March 2015.
